What are Loose Leaf Wraps?

Loose Leaf Wraps are thin, flexible sheets made from natural materials such as hemp, flax, or other plant fibers. Unlike pre-rolled cigarettes or joints, Loose Leaf Wraps allow users to customize their smoking experience by choosing the type and amount of herbs or tobacco they prefer. These wraps are typically unbleached and free from additives, making them a healthier option for those who prioritize natural products.

Types of Loose Leaf Wraps

Loose Leaf Wraps come in various types, each with its unique characteristics:

  • Hemp Wraps: Made from hemp fibers, these wraps are known for their durability and natural flavor. They are often preferred by those who enjoy a smoother smoking experience.
  • Flax Wraps: Flax wraps are made from flax fibers and are known for their thin and delicate texture. They burn evenly and provide a clean taste.
  • Rice Paper Wraps: These wraps are made from rice paper and are popular for their light and airy texture. They are often used for rolling herbs and tobacco blends.

How to Roll Loose Leaf Wraps

Rolling Loose Leaf Wraps can be a bit tricky at first, but with practice, it becomes a straightforward process. Here are the steps to roll a perfect Loose Leaf Wrap:

  1. Choose your Loose Leaf Wrap: Select the type of wrap that suits your preference.
  2. Prepare your herbs or tobacco: Grind your herbs or tobacco to a fine consistency. This ensures an even burn and better flavor.
  3. Place the wrap: Lay the wrap flat on a clean surface. The shiny side should be facing down.
  4. Add your mixture: Sprinkle a small amount of your herb or tobacco mixture onto the wrap, about 0.5 to 1 gram, depending on your preference.
  5. Roll the wrap: Start rolling from the bottom, using your fingers to shape the wrap around the mixture. Keep rolling until you reach the top, ensuring the wrap is tightly sealed.
  6. Lick the edge: Moisten the edge of the wrap with a bit of water or saliva to seal it. Be careful not to use too much moisture, as it can make the wrap soggy.
  7. Twist the ends: Gently twist the ends of the wrap to create a filter-like tip. This helps to prevent the mixture from falling out and makes it easier to inhale.
